NATO parliamentary leaders meet in Istanbul on defense spending, investment

The NATO parliamentary summit opened in Istanbul on Monday, with alliance officials calling for stronger defense investment ahead of next week's NATO leaders' summit in Ankara.

The two-day summit brought together parliamentary speakers and delegation heads from NATO's 32 member states to discuss security issues. Opening the meeting, NATO Parliamentary Assembly President Marcos Perestrello stressed the critical role of national parliaments in supporting defense investment and implementing the alliance's security priorities.

NATO Deputy Secretary General Radmila Shekerinska stated that the upcoming NATO heads of state and government summit, scheduled for July 7-8 in Ankara, will serve as a platform to demonstrate the alliance's collective "defense readiness and resolve."
